My winter trip was 2 weeks long including two days in Dublin before catching a flight to London. Spent 8 days in United Kingdom then another four days in beautiful Spain.

London was not really awesome for me. Its an old city, historic looking and there's too many people. Crowded and havoc. Frankly, we don't really enjoy London. I guess we are too indulge with the peacefulness of Galway. Hehe.. In London, we stayed in an apartment which quite a distance from the city. Nevertheless, it was worth it cause it was really comfy and the owner, Liz was very friendly and nice. I met my friend, Illiany at the Oxford Street. Oxford Street is a famous shopping heaven where you can find many Malaysians there. Trust me, there's too many of Malaysians! Personally, I don't think the price are cheaper unless the brand is really originate from this continent. Like for example, Long Champ brand that is amazingly famous in Malaysia now has a price difference of almost RM500 per bag. Well, you can save a lot but if to compare the price of the ticket. Hurmm, just forget about it. But the designs are different here, so I think somehow it is worth buying. There are too many things to be explored in London especially the musuems and galleries. But in term of cleanliness, its not as clean as you would imagine a Western country will look like. What I mean here, since I was young it has been installed in my mind that those countries are extremely clean but apparently it wasn't. At certain places, to some extent I felt that Malaysia is way cleaner. Owh, and one more thing about London. Halal food is easily available at a very cheap price. What I mean by cheap here is in comparison with the one that we have in Galway/Dublin. Even, if you compare relatively to Malaysian Ringgit (do not convert it) it was still cheaper.
